Ordinals
beta
Sat 936700626105506
decimal
187340.626105506
degree
0°187340′1868″626105506‴
percentile
44.6047917683751%
name
hffpmhdhlxn
cycle
0
epoch
0
period
92
block
187340
offset
626105506
timestamp
2012-07-03 12:03:05 UTC
rarity
common
prev
next